图解HTTP之HTTP首部

版权声明:转载请注明原文链接 https://blog.csdn.net/NVPS_wyj/article/details/82837921

HTTP首部字段

HTTP首部字段根据用途分为4类:通用首部字段、请求首部字段、响应首部字段、实体首部字段。

通用首部字段

通用字段是指请求报文和响应报文都会使用的首部。

  1. Cache-Control
    public:public指令表示其他用户也能使用缓存
    private:private指令表示服务器只会对特定的用户返回缓存
    no-cache:表示客户端不会接受过期的缓存
    no-store:不就行缓存
    max-age:客户端接收比此指令值小的缓存资源
    s-maxage:类似max-age,但只适用于公共缓存服务器
    min-fresh:
    max-stale:客户端接收指定时间内的响应(即使过期也接收)
    only-if-cached:
    must-revalidate:代理会向源服务器再次验证即将返回的响应缓存目前是否仍然有效
    proxy-revalidate:
    no-transform:无论在请求还是响应中,缓存都不能改变实体主体的媒体类型
  2. Connection
  3. Date
  4. Pragma
  5. Trailer
  6. Trailer-Encoding
  7. Upgrade
  8. Via
  9. Warning

请求首部字段

响应首部字段

实体首部字段

为Cookie服务的首部字段

猜你喜欢

转载自blog.csdn.net/NVPS_wyj/article/details/82837921